






















Abstract:In terms of the existence of a single clopen set and two related nets, we characterize when the full Boolean algebra, ${\mathfrak B}(G)$, of clopen subsets of a topological group $G$ is left introverted. We employ this characterization to show that when $G$ is a first countable, $\sigma$-compact, totally disconnected locally compact group, ${\mathfrak B}(G)$ is left introverted if and only if $G$ is compact or discrete, thus providing a strong positive answer to a question posed in Stephens and Stokke (Q J Math 2023). Examples of clopen sets and nets witnessing our non-introversion theorem are presented. Some hereditary properties of left introversion of ${\mathfrak B}(G)$ are proved and then employed to extend our main result to other classes of topological groups.
